Transaction e151c12553957b6dc68b31099df4c012a94599f3389f6f2b5ec9fecfb4f13ba4

3 Input
2 Outputs
  • e151c12553957b6dc68b31099df4c012a94599f3389f6f2b5ec9fecfb4f13ba4:0
  • value  49401020
    address  1P17jAEgKAvf88arkFpdKcFW51RL95CYcC
  • e151c12553957b6dc68b31099df4c012a94599f3389f6f2b5ec9fecfb4f13ba4:1
  • value  1001063
    address  1DfRcwoaYmhnYd2CGrPikbJTqj8hfhbXJe